> > >I notice that the HTML 4.0 spec says the class attribute
> > >can be a space-separated list of names. That sounds like
> > >you could have both element name and role value as
> > >class values in a div class attribute. But how do you
> > >write CSS to deal with that, and do the browsers support
> > >such syntax?

> I ignored the question because I thought my mail had already
> answered it.
>
> If you have class="foo bar baz" in an element, any of the
> following selectors will work:
>
> .foo
> .bar
> .baz
Is that really a "will work", or more of a "should work"?
My not-extensive experience in writing CSS is that
different browsers support different subsets of CSS1, let
alone CSS2. I found it hard to have one stylesheet that
worked as it should in all browsers.
